Background technique
Wet dedusting technology is also washing type dedusting technology, is a kind of mutual using water or other liquid and dusty gas Contact, with the transmitting of heat, matter, the technology for separating grit with gas by washing.Wet-way dust-collector has structure letter It is single, cheap, purification efficiency is high, suitable for purify non-fiber and with water occur chemical action various dust it is excellent Point is particularly suitable for cleaning high-temp, inflammable, explosive gas.Current Wet-way dust-collector, the water after dedusting contain largely Dirt, it is difficult to separation is filtered to it.

The embodiments of the present invention is: 101 domestic demand of accommodating cavity first is passed through water from inlet 105, will then contain Dust and gas body is passed through gas-guide tube 300, and as gas-guide tube 300 flows, if gas divide in stomata 301 be isolated be divided into several beams or Dry bubble is simultaneously entered in accommodating cavity 101 in the form of bubble, and gas is flowed from water to gas outlet 201, and gas outlet is discharged 201, complete dedusting work.When needing to clear up water, flocculant is launched into water by cleaning passage 202, and wait dirt Sedimentation, obtain flocculate and waste water, open the second valve 120 and third valve 620, by waste water and flocculate from liquid outlet In 103 discharge processes, flocculate can be trapped in filter chamber 611 by cartridge filter 610, so that flocculate is separated.It is beneficial to effect Fruit can be individually filtered out the dirt in waste water, so that waste water obtains preliminary treatment, facilitate subsequent so that waste water and dirt are separated Wastewater treatment and discharge.
To enable the contact area of dusty gas and water bigger, promote dust removing effects, in one embodiment, it is described just In the dusty gas processing equipment of wastewater treatment further include partition 400, the side wall chain of the partition 400 and the accommodating cavity 101 It connects, and the partition 400 is set between the gas-guide tube 300 and the gas outlet 201, if being offered on the partition 400 Interfere discharge orifice 401.Partition 400 in accommodating cavity 101 is set, for slowing down movement velocity of the gas in accommodating cavity 101, is made It is longer to obtain gas residence time, can be longer with the time of contact of this dusty gas and water, to promote Water warfare dusty gas Effect.
It is in one embodiment, described convenient for wastewater treatment to remove water the dusty gas crossed by Water warfare Dusty gas processing equipment further includes defogging mechanism 500, and the defogging mechanism 500 includes demisting pipe 510 and demisting plate 520, institute Demisting pipe 510 is stated with demisting channel 511, the demisting plate 520 is set in the demisting channel 511, the demisting pipe 510 One end connect with the top cover 200, and the demisting channel 511 is connected to the gas outlet 201.It is come out in gas outlet 201 Purification gas, many moisture of band, after purification gas is passed through demisting pipe 510, demisting plate 520 can be by the moisture in purification gas It is trapped in demisting plate 520, so that purification gas humidity declines.
Specifically, the gas-guide tube include the first pipe 310, the second pipe 320 and third pipe 330, the one of second pipe 320 End is connect with first pipe 310, and the other end of second pipe 320 is connect with one end of the third pipe 330, the third The other end of pipe 330 wears the air inlet, and the outer surface of the part third pipe 330 is connect with the air inlet, and The air inlet is closed, the third pipe 330 in the accommodating cavity offers several points of stomatas, and the air guide channel passes through each Described point of stomata is connected to the accommodating cavity;The central axis of second pipe 320 and the centerline axis parallel of the tank body, and The length of second pipe 320 is greater than the length of the tank body.In this way, water can rest on when the aqueous reflux is into diversion pipe The position of second pipe 320, avoids its refluence, and certainly, when being passed through dusty gas by the first pipe 310, gas will push stop Accommodating cavity is returned in the water flow of the second pipe 320, not will cause the blocking of the second pipe 320, and dusty gas can be smoothly along first Pipe 310, the second pipe 320 and third pipe 330 flow, and stomata is finally divided to arrive at accommodating cavity.
When to make dusty gas by dividing stomata 301, dusty gas dispersion is more uniform, in one embodiment, respectively Described point of stomata 301 is placed equidistant with.When dusty gas passes through each point of stomata 301, several beams or several bubbles are separated into, at this time Due to dividing stomata 301 to be placed equidistant with, so that the interval between each bubble is uniform, the case where polymerizeing between each bubble is reduced, so that Dusty gas is more effectively contacted with water, improves the clean-up effect of dusty gas.
The flow velocity being passed through for control dusty gas is provided with air valve on the gas-guide tube 300 in one embodiment.It is logical The opening and closing degree of toning air throttle is controlled the circulation of dusty gas, realizes speed-regulating function.
To make tank body 100 more durable, in one embodiment, the cross sectional shape of the accommodating cavity 101 is circle Shape.The section of accommodating cavity 101 is circle, so that the liquid being located in accommodating cavity 101 is equal to the pressure of the side wall of accommodating cavity 101 It is even, 100 uniform force of tank body, to slow down the trend that compressive deformation is used for a long time in tank body 100, so that tank body 100 is more solid It is durable.
To make tank body 100 convenient for safeguarding, in one embodiment, the top cover 200 detachably connects with the tank body 100 It connects.In this way, top cover 200 can be disassembled from tank body 100, so that personnel are able to the inside of cleaning tank body 100.
In process of production, equipment is needed far from ground, in order to be safeguarded to equipment, in one embodiment, institute The bottom for stating tank body 100 is provided with bracket.Bracket can make tank body 100 far from ground, prevent excess surface water from leading to tank body 100 Electrochemical corrosion occurs for outer surface, so that wet scrubber is convenient for safeguarding.
To make gas-guide tube 300 more durable, in one embodiment, the cross sectional shape of the gas-guide tube 300 is circle. Cross sectional shape is that the compression capability of circular gas-guide tube 300 is stronger, so that gas-guide tube 300 has preferably by pressure under pneumatic pressure Degree, enables gas-guide tube 300 more durable.
For convenient for 610 slag dumping of cartridge filter, in one embodiment, the screen pipe 600 detachably connects with the tank body 100 It connects.After screen pipe 600 is disassembled from tank body 100, cartridge filter 610 can be taken out out of screen pipe 600, to facilitate certain The flocculate in cartridge filter 610 is cleared up after time, avoids flocculate from accumulating, so that filter effect is more preferably.
To realize being detachably connected between screen pipe 600 and tank body 100, specifically, the screen pipe 600 and the tank Body 100 is spirally connected.It is spirally connected simple with structure, and the effect of good airproof performance, can effectively avoid liquid from screen pipe 600 and tank body 100 junction exudation.
To make flocculate is convenient to be discharged from liquid outlet 103, in one embodiment, the section of the liquid outlet 103 is wide It spends from one end close to 101 bottom of accommodating cavity and is gradually reduced to the other end, in this way, flocculate falls in the side of liquid outlet 103 It when wall, can gradually fall with the side wall of liquid outlet 103, avoid what flocculate under 101 bottom level situation of accommodating cavity was accumulated Situation, so that flocculate is convenient for discharge.
Because equipment is processing dusty gas, when dusty gas flows through 101 side wall of accommodating cavity, there is very big frictional force, hold The side wall of accommodating cavity 101 easy to wear, in addition, the process of dedusting operates in the environment of having water again, the side of perishable accommodating cavity 101 Wall, to prevent from wearing and corrode, in one embodiment, the side wall of the accommodating cavity 101 is provided with wear-and corrosion-resistant layer, with this reality The effect of existing wear-and corrosion-resistant, specifically, the wear-and corrosion-resistant layer are diamondite layer, and diamondite has good wear-resisting Performance and antiseptic property avoid the side wall of accommodating cavity 101 from wearing or corrode with this.
To make the shunting effect in flow-disturbing hole 401 more preferably, in one embodiment, the flow-disturbing on each partition 400 401 arranged in matrix of hole, so that each flow-disturbing hole 401 is evenly distributed, so that the effect for shunting dusty gas is more preferable.To make Dusty gas can stop the longer time in accommodating cavity 101, in one embodiment, the quantity of the partition 400 be it is multiple, this Sample, each partition 400 can slow down flowing velocity of the dusty gas in accommodating cavity 101, so that dusty gas be enabled to accommodate The residence time is longer in chamber 101, increases dust removing effects.Further, the flow-disturbing hole 401 on each partition 400 with The flow-disturbing hole 401 on the adjacent partition 400 is staggered, in this way, the flow-disturbing hole 401 on each partition 400 with Flow-disturbing hole 401 in adjacent separator 400 be not it is in linear relation, enable dusty gas need tortuous by disturbing on each partition 400 Discharge orifice 401 enables dusty gas that can stop the longer time in accommodating cavity 101, so that dust removing effects are more preferable.
It is discharged or is isolated preferably to control the water in accommodating cavity 101 containing flocculate, in one embodiment, institute Stating the second valve 120 is butterfly valve, and butterfly valve structure is simple, and the multiple types fluid such as solution and solid can be allowed to pass through, solid in control It is with good stability when the flow of liquid mixture.
The function of fluid flow is controlled to realize the first valve 110 with third valve 620, it is in one embodiment, described First valve 110 and the third valve 620 are respectively solenoid valve, and solenoid valve control fluid flow is very accurate, convenient for control Flow rate of liquid.
